As a Substation Foreman, you will play a key role in the successful delivery of substation construction projects by leading field crews, coordinating daily installation activities, and ensuring work is executed safely, efficiently, and in alignment with project specifications. You will be responsible for planning work fronts, managing materials, interpreting construction drawings, and supporting site leadership in driving productivity, quality, and schedule performance. This role is critical in maintaining strong communication between field teams and project leadership while upholding Aecon’s standards of safety and operational excellence.

Requirements

  • Minimum of 3+ years of substation field experience, including at least 1+ year in a Subforeman or leadership capacity, with hands-on experience across key substation scopes.
  • Proven experience in: Foundation installation in line with engineered specifications
  • Conduit installation and routing within substation environments
  • Ground grid installation and grounding systems
  • Precast trench installation and site integration
  • Cable tray installation for structured cable management
  • Structural steel installation and alignment
  • Apparatus installation and equipment setting
  • Bus work installation with proper clearances and fit-up
  • Low-voltage cable installation, termination, and wiring

Responsibilities

  • Interpret Issued for Construction (IFC) drawings and provide redlines to the Site Supervisor as required
  • Oversee and execute installation activities for assigned crews, ensuring quality and productivity targets are met
  • Plan weekly work fronts, coordinate tasks, and organize materials to support efficient execution
  • Identify and communicate material and consumable needs to the Site Supervisor in a timely manner
  • Support resolution of on-site issues and assist in managing crew-level disputes
  • Communicate site conditions and constraints to the Construction Manager, including resourcing, site services, and materials
  • Manage crew timesheets and ensure accuracy of daily reporting
  • Promote and uphold Aecon’s safety culture, ensuring all work is performed in compliance with safety standards
